Unknown Substance Thrown Into D-Dot Bus Sends 4 To Hospital

DETROIT (WWJ) - Four people went sent to the hospital after Detroit police say someone threw some kind of substance onto a D-DOT bus.

Police say it happened at Warren and Grandmont, near Southfield Freeway on the city's west side. They continue to search for the suspect who fled on foot.

It's not clear what the substance was or if it was harmful.

The conditions of the four people on the bus are unknown.
